

Lindsay
Kammeier – Lindsay joined the Leadership Coaching Committee in 2014.
She works as an Assistant Engineer for Schaaf & Wheeler, which specializes
in water resources civil design work in the San Francisco Bay Area. She
graduated from Cal Poly, San Luis Obispo with a B.S. in Civil Engineering. During her college years she was very
involved with SWE, holding a section officer position for 4 years, and serving
as Region B’s RCCE in FY13. She also mentored incoming female engineering
freshmen, and is proud that several of her mentees became section officers as
well. Her hobbies include yoga, reading,
baking, and music.

Claudia
Galván - Claudia has led product development at Oracle, Adobe and Microsoft reaching
billions of people around the world. In the last few years she has focused on
helping startups in Silicon Valley launch products internationally. Claudia is
a community leader empowering women and Latinos in STEM. She is a former
section president of Santa Clara Valley SWE, former Sr. Director at the Anita
Borg Institute, Board Member at Notre Dame High School and mentor at the
TechWomen program. She is currently a doctoral candidate at Drexel
University researching strategies to increase the pipeline of women in STEM.
She has been a recipient of many awards including Silicon Valley Women of
Influence in 2015 and SWE Region A Distinguished Leader Award.
